French shipping giant CMA CGM flags container ship in India

CMA CGM has become the first major foreign shipping company to register its vessel in India in a show of confidence to government’s maritime policies.

On Monday the French shipping giant announced that one of its container ship CMA CGM Vitoria will fly under the Indian flag. This vessel which previously flew under the Maltese flag has can carry 2592 twenty feet long containers. It will ply between India, West Asia and the Red Sea.

The flagging ceremony follows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s visit to CMA CGM headquarters during his visit to France. CMA CGM is the world’s third largest container shipping company.

“We are working constantly to expand Indian flagged vessels’ fleet to strengthen our position in global trade, build resilience, ensure stability in supply chains and create opportunities for the Indian marine sector,” union minister of ports and shipping Sarbananda Sonowal said on the occasion.

In addition to its first local flag registration in India, the French company will register three more vessels in the coming months, underscoring its commitment to India and its ambition to further develop its presence in the country. CMA CGM has also become the first foreign shipping line to register a containerized vessel in the International Financial Services Centre, Gift City in Gujarat.

CMA CGM said India is a strategic country for the company and it intends to actively contribute to the India Middle East Europe economic corridor.
